Abstract

This rear axle of a chassis is suitable for installation in a toy vehicle which is operated as a track-guided vehicle on a raceway. The chassis has a front and rear axles and a guide wedge which is movable about a vertical pivot axle to cooperate with a groove on the track in the front area. The rear axle is driven by an electric motor, with the rear axle and the electric motor together forming a module. To optimize the driving properties of the toy vehicle, the module of the toy vehicle is held in position on a receptacle section of the chassis with the mediation of a guide arm-spring system.

Claims

exact text as granted — not AI-modified
1 . Chassis rear axle arrangement for a toy vehicle operated as a track-guided raceway vehicle having a front axle and a guide wedge movable about a vertical pivot axle cooperates with a track groove at a chassis front area, the rear axle driven by an electric motor which together form a module wherein the module is held in position on a receptacle section of the chassis via a guide arm-spring system.  
     
     
         2 . Chassis rear axle arrangement as recited in  claim 1 , wherein the guide arm spring system comprises at least one guide arm and at least one spring arm.  
     
     
         3 . Chassis rear axle arrangement as recited in  claim 1 , wherein the guide arm is arranged to extend between the module and the receptacle section in a longitudinal direction of the vehicle and in a central longitudinal plane.  
     
     
         4 . Chassis rear axle arrangement as recited in  claim 3 , wherein the guide arm spring system comprises at least one guide arm and at least one spring arm.  
     
     
         5 . Chassis rear axle arrangement as recited in  claim 3 , wherein the guide arm is mounted on the module and the receptacle section of articulated joints.  
     
     
         6 . Chassis rear axle arrangement as recited in  claim 5 , wherein the articulated joints are film joints.  
     
     
         7 . Chassis rear axle arrangement as recited in  claim 2 , wherein the guide arm-spring system comprises two spring arms on sides of a central longitudinal axis of the vehicle.  
     
     
         8 . Chassis rear axle arrangement as recited in  claim 7 , wherein the guide arm is arranged to extend between the module and the receptacle section in a longitudinal direction of the vehicle and in a central longitudinal plane.  
     
     
         9 . Chassis rear axle arrangement as recited in  claim 2 , wherein the at least one guide arm and at least one spring arm are connected to at least one of upright bearing sections of the module and the receptacle section.  
     
     
         10 . Chassis rear axle arrangement as recited in  claim 2 , wherein the at least one guide arm and the at least one spring arm are arranged on sides of a roll axle viewed from a side of the toy vehicle, said roll axle rising from bottom to top against a travel direction of the toy vehicle.  
     
     
         11 . Chassis rear axle arrangement as recited in  claim 10 , the at least one guide arm is situated above the roll axle, and the at least one spring arm is situated beneath the roll axle.
